Six prisoners who escaped from an Alabama prison Tuesday are back behind bars tonight.
Police caught up with them several states away in Tennessee- Jennifer Jones is there.

((THE SIXTH ESCAPEE CAPTURED WAS PERHAPS THE MOST DANGEROUS. CONVICTED MURDERED GARY SCOTT ELUDED POLICE FOR SEVERAL HOURS ON THURSDAY, BUT WAS FINALLY TRACKED DOWN THANKS TO A TIP FROM A LOCAL RESIDENT.

SOT:

"THERE WERE THREE TROOPER CARS UNDER A BRIDGE, I TOLD THEM TO COME HERE, AND SAID THERE'S A GUY UNDER THIS BRIDGE WITH A RED SHIRT ON."
THE MASSIVE MANHUNT BEGAN OVERNIGHT IN TENNESSEE...WHEN A PAIR OF SHERIFF'S DEPUTIES STUMBLED UPON THE ESCAPEES ALONG A DESERTED ROAD WHILE SEARCHING FOR A PETTY THIEF.

SOT: CARL HUTCHINSON/SHERIFF DEPUTY

"IT'S JUST A STROKE OF LUCK, I DIDN'T EVEN KNOW THAT ROAD WAS HERE."
THE INMATES SCATTERED INTO THE WOODS... HOWEVER FIVE OF THEM WERE CAPTURED WITHIN HOURS AFTER AN ARMY OF LAW ENFORCEMENT PERSONNEL AND TRACKING DOGS RESPONDED.
ONE OF THE INMATES TALKED ABOUT WHAT IT WAS LIKE TO BE FREE FOR THREE DAYS.

SOT: JAMES MCCLAIN/CAPTURED INMATE


THE MEN HAD BEEN ON THE RUN SINCE TUESDAY WHEN THEY MANAGED ESCAPE AN ALABAMA PRISON BY USING A BROOM HANDLE TO SLIP UNDER AN ELECTRIC FENCE. PRISON OFFICIALS THERE ARE BLAMING THE ESCAPE ON A LACK OF MANPOWER AND AN ALARM SYSTEM THAT DIDN'T WORK PROPERLY.

Its owners are in prison- they're serving time for fraud and embezzlement.
Now the contents of Huddleston's famed "Dora" estate are going on the auction block.
(------------)
[VO-NAT]
[SUPER=04-File Tape]


Dorothy Saunders and Thelma Mae Barger were convicted last year of defrauding two elderly sisters out of their life savings.
They used the money to help build this 12- thousand square foot mansion and fill it with expensive furniture, china and paintings.
All of it will be up for bid on February 17th.

The Virginia State Police are investigating the Governor's Political Action Committee over its phone banks.
(------------)
[VO-NAT]
[SUPER=03-Richmond]


And the first Governor Jim Gilmore apparently heard of it was from reporters today.
The probe is into whether his New Majority PAC phone banks are initiating calls between voters and Senate Finance Committee members, and then listening in.

Moms are usually the one's keeping their children out of harm's way- not the case though in one Massachusetts town- where a six year old saved her mother.
(------------)
[VO-NAT]
[SUPER=03-Millbury, MA]


Lauren Casey was with her mom Deborah sledding on Sunday.
After Lauren went down the hill on her inner tube, mom tried to do the same. But Deborah Casey hit a bump, and was thrown from the tube injuring her back and legs and leaving her unable to walk.
It was in the evening- Superbowl Sunday- no other sledders were around.
Lauren- who's only 35 pounds- was able to help her mom back onto an inner tube and drag her up a hill- to a nearby road.

While research shows that electric toothbrushes do clean better than manual versions -- Doctor Steven Anama(uh-nam-ah) --says there's really not that big of a difference.

Besides Anama says electric toothbrushes can be expensive costing anywhere from 7 to 150 dollars.
And he warns that some electric toothbrushes can cause damage.
(///// SOT /////)
[SOT33:45]
[IN Q=The sonicare toothbrush]

((THE SONICARE TOOTHBRUSH, THAT DOES VIBRATIONS CAN CAUSE DAMAGE SOME RESTORATIONS, SOME CROWN AND BRIDGE WORK CAN DO THAT)) [RUNS12]
[OUT Q=do that]


But as far as the best electric toothbrush on the market -- he recommends the Rota -dent. Because it's the most similar to what is used in the dentist office.
And if you're looking for the most affordable -- Anama says the colgate brand is the way to go.
Whatever method choose, Anama says brushing at least twice day day is essential.
And remember to practice the proper technique --small circular motions.
